AEROTHERMODYNAMIC CHARACTERISTICS OF TWO-DIMENSIONAL BLUFF BODIES IN HYPERSONIC VISCOUS FLOWS

Riabov V. V., Yegorov I. V.*, Yegorova M. V.*
Daniel Webster College, Nashua, New Hampshire, USA; Central AeroHydrodynamics Institute (TsAGI), Russia

Keywords: aerothermodynamic characteristics, two-dimensional bluff bodies, hypersonic viscous flows

The flow structure about two-dimensional bluff bodies (two irregular cylinders in tandem, plate-cylinder configurations, and torus) in hypersonic viscous flow has been studied. The grid equations approximated the Navier-Stokes equations were numerically solved by application of the second-order implicit monotonized scheme, the modified Newton's method, and the Christoffel-Schwartz grid-transformation technique.
